Russian Helicopters, the country's primary manufacturer of military rotorcraft, has admitted that some of its helicopters have been brought down by first-person view (FPV) drones. In a rare acknowledgment of vulnerability, the company revealed that it is working on solutions to combat this new type of threat
Despite a dire need for tanks in the war against Ukraine, the Russian MoD has not placed orders for its showpiece tank, the T-14 or Armata. At the Army-2024 Forum, tank manufacturer UralVagonZavod (UVZ) expressed readiness to start production of the T-14s once the Russian government places an order

Russias ROSOBORONEXPORT today unveiled a new mobile electronic warfare (EW) center based on the PLASTUN-SN tracked armored vehicle at the Army 2024 arms fair. The vehicle houses the SHIELD electronic warfare system which can suppress the electronic signals of first person view (FPV) and other drones
The Royal Navy's new warship protection decoy system, Ancilia will be fitted to all six Type 45 destroyers as well as the entire next-generation frigate force. This includes eight Type 26 City-class submarine hunters and five Type 31 Inspiration-class general purpose warships
The United States Air Force has negotiated a price of $2,560,846,860 with Boeing for the E-7A Wedgetail weapon system rapid prototype program. This paves the way for the delivery of two operationally representative prototype E-7A weapons systems, the US Air Force said in a release
Russia has begun evacuating people from the western Lipetsk region after Fridays "massive” Ukrainian drone attack sparked explosions, power disruptions, and injured six people. Lipetsk is located about 460 km south of Moscow and roughly 300 km from Ukraine's eastern border
